You guys won't build a road unless it has logical termini - right?-
A state DOT won't PLAN a road that does not have logical termini, but
it might be built in segments as money becomes available. Big
difference in the ultimate plan, and the execution of it. It seems
the same is true of bike/ped networks, at least when they are being
paid for piecemeal by development instead of being built as an end-to-
end larger public project. If things are being built piecemeal, one
would hope there is a regional plan in place that ultimately will
provide useful origins and destinations when everything fills in. I
understand the desirability and frustration of trying to set up a
regional bike/ped fund to build logical segments rather than piecemeal
frontage construction...I know a community that tried to do something
similar, and they couldn't get all the developers on board, so they
went back to the piecemeal approach.
